Analysis
The most recent figure for completion rate, lower secondary education, both sexes in Croatia is 99.6%, measured in 2021. That is the highest value across all 16 years on record.
That represents a change of up 1.2% on the previous year and up 1.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, completion rate, lower secondary education, both sexes in Croatia peaked at 99.6% in 2021 and was at its lowest, 97.7%, in 2010.
That places Croatia 5th out of 92 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the top 10%.
Completion rate, lower secondary education, both sexes in Croatia,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2006 | 98.7% | — |
| 2007 | 99.1% | +0.4% |
| 2008 | 98.5% | -0.6% |
| 2009 | 98.9% | +0.4% |
| 2010 | 97.7% | -1.2% |
| 2011 | 98.6% | +0.9% |
| 2012 | 99.5% | +0.9% |
| 2013 | 99.0% | -0.5% |
| 2014 | 98.9% | -0.1% |
| 2015 | 98.8% | -0.1% |
| 2016 | 98.8% | +0.0% |
| 2017 | 99.0% | +0.2% |
| 2018 | 99.0% | +0.0% |
| 2019 | 98.6% | -0.4% |
| 2020 | 98.3% | -0.3% |
| 2021 | 99.6% | +1.2% |
